Benjamin Langlois Lefroy R.N.Explanation
Son of Captain Lefroy, of Cardenton, County Kildare
 
Date (from)(Date to)Personal
7 April 1858 Married Eleanor Jane, only daughter of Henry Surmon, of Canonbury.
 
DateRank
10 May 1854Lieutenant
25 March 1863Commander
1 October 1873Retired Captain
 
Date fromDate toService
31 October 1854 Lieutenant in Tartar, commanded by Hugh Dunlop, the Baltic during the Russian War
24 December 1854 Lieutenant in Blenheim, commanded by William Hutcheon Hall, the Baltic during the Russian War
3 June 1856 Lieutenant in Pioneer, commanded by George Pechell Mends, North America and West Indies
13 October 1858 Lieutenant in Pembroke, commanded by Edward Philips Charlewood, Coast Guard, Harwich
13 December 186125 March 1863Lieutenant and commander in Investigator (from commissioning at Woolwich), west coast of Africa
1 August 1864 Inspecting Commander, Coast Guard
8 March 186724 December 1868Commander in Spiteful, south-east coast of America, then 1868 Abyssinian expedition (a punitive expedition against the Emperor of Ethiopia, Tewodros II, who had written to the British Government requesting their help in his wars with his neighbours. When he received no answer to his letter, he took offence and made a number of British officials and missionaries his prisoners).
